Meteorological Initilization Data

Meteorological Initilization Data Information dialog allows for the input of Date (day of month code YY) and Time (hour code GG), Wind Measurement type (code iw), Weather Group (code ix), Position (latitude code LaLaLa, longitude code LoLoLoLo, quadrant code Qc). This dialog also allows for input of observer initials, determination of units used and comments.

Ship Radio Call Sign -
Definition: Ship's call sign consisting of three or more alphanumeric characters. This value is taken from the administration file

Dialog Operation: This ship's call sign must be set in the Administration Report.

Dry Bulb
Definition: Air temperature to tenths of a degree Celsius. It is the measurement of the heat content of the air.

Method of Measurement: Thermometer of psychrometer. Take the reading on the windward side of the ship being sure to protect thermometer from radiation, precipitation, and spray.

Dialog Operation: The signed dry bulb temperature is recorded in the edit box in Celsius up tenths of a degree. The code TTT is the temperature to tenths of a degree without the decimal point. Sn is the sign.
Wet Bulb
Definition: Definition: Wet bulb temperature in degrees Celsius. This is that temperature at which water evaporated into the air brings the air to saturation at the same temperature.

Method of Measurement: Psychrometer. The thermometer must be read as soon as possible after ventilation or whirling has stopped. Moisten clean wet bulb muslin on all sides with purest (distilled) water available. If temperature is below 0 degrees C, the muslin wicking should be covered with a thin coating of ice.

Dialog Operation: The signed wet bulb temperature is recorded in Celsius to tenths of a degree and the signed value is input into the edit box. The code TbTbTb is temperature to tenths of a degree without the decimal point. The sign and type of wet bulb is selected from the list box using the mouse or the up down arrow keys. Code Sw automatically selected.
Dew Point
Definition: This is the temperature in Celsius at which condensation will occur causing dew or frost to form. It corresponds to a relative humidity of 100%.

Method of Measurement: It is computed from the wet bulb and dry bulb temperature.

Dialog Operation: It is automatically calculated from the dry and wet bulb.
